1. Set Clear Study Goals

Before beginning a study session, decide what you want to accomplish.

Instead of saying:

“I will study physics.”

Set a more specific goal:

“I will review the laws of motion and solve five practice questions.”

A specific goal gives the session a clear direction.

At the end, you can check whether you completed the task.

5. Use Active Learning

Active learning means doing something with the information rather than simply reading it repeatedly.

For example, after reading a topic, try to:

  • Explain it in your own words.
  • Answer questions.
  • Create a short summary.
  • Draw a diagram.
  • Solve a problem.
  • Teach the concept to someone else.

Active learning can help you identify what you understand and what still needs review.

8. Practice With Questions

Practice questions are particularly useful for subjects that require problem-solving.

After studying a topic, answer questions without immediately checking the solution.

Then compare your answer with the correct one.

If you make a mistake, identify why.

Was the problem caused by:

  • A misunderstanding?
  • A calculation error?
  • Forgetting a formula?
  • Misreading the question?

Understanding mistakes can make practice more useful.

15. Ask for Help When Needed

Independent learning is valuable, but students do not have to solve every problem alone.

If a topic remains confusing, ask:

  • A teacher.
  • A classmate.
  • A tutor.
  • A parent or family member.
  • A reliable educational resource.

Asking a specific question is often more useful than simply saying, “I don’t understand.”

For example:

“I understand the first step, but I don’t understand why this formula is used in the second step.”

This gives the person helping you a clear starting point.

18. Use a Reading and Revision System

Reading alone does not always guarantee understanding.

After reading a chapter, try this process:

Read

Understand the main ideas.

Recall

Close the book and explain what you remember.

Write

Record important points.

Practice

Answer relevant questions.

Review

Return to difficult areas later.

This turns reading into an active learning process.

A Simple Study Session

Here is an example of a structured study session:

First 5 Minutes — Prepare

Choose the topic and remove distractions.

Next 20 Minutes — Learn

Read the lesson and understand the main concepts.

Next 10 Minutes — Recall

Close the material and explain what you remember.

Next 10 Minutes — Practice

Answer questions or solve problems.

Final 5 Minutes — Review

Write down what you learned and identify anything that needs further study.

This is only an example. Students can adjust the timing to suit their needs.

Common Study Mistakes

Studying Without a Goal

Starting without knowing what you want to accomplish can make a session unfocused.

Reading Without Testing Yourself

Repeated reading can create a feeling of familiarity without confirming actual understanding.

Ignoring Difficult Topics

Avoiding difficult material can create larger problems later.

Using Too Many Resources

Too many books and websites can become confusing.

Studying Only Before Exams

Leaving everything until the last moment can make revision difficult.

Keeping an Unrealistic Schedule

A timetable that is impossible to maintain will eventually be abandoned.
